Fiftieth Legislature - Second Regular Session (2012)

AI Summary

  • State treasurer shall distribute 5% of monthly transaction privilege tax revenues collected on Indian reservations to qualifying Indian tribes for JTED support.

  • Monies must be used exclusively for operations, maintenance, renewal, and capital expenses of joint technical education districts formed on the tribe's own reservation.

  • Qualifying Indian tribes must enter into a compact with the state (signed by governor) for a minimum 10-year term, with renewal possible for additional 10-year periods after legislative budget committee review.

  • Compact must require audits by the auditor general, with audit copies submitted to the joint legislative budget committee, and may require reimbursement to the Department of Revenue for implementation costs not exceeding $150,000.

  • "Qualifying Indian tribe" is defined as an Indian tribe that has a joint technical education district formed on its own reservation in Arizona.
